HPLC is a form of column chromatography that pumps a sample mixture or analyte in a solvent (mobile phase) at high pressure through a column with chromatographic packing material (stationary phase). It is used separate, identify, and quantify each component in a mixture. Separation is based on the interaction between mobile and stationary phase. It can be used for separation of volatile and non-volatile components.
